Output 610458e417ef21dcb04d752709fadb9a1ae2b1cf39dc90b51cb0bfeee8698050:1

value
17630996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c14777e6b6c1fd162036b4d8d25a0d9bbae5b88 OP_EQUAL
address
3ETh3TRJ3ei8pQsGuUz1ShjpcUCfvdUYWk
transaction
610458e417ef21dcb04d752709fadb9a1ae2b1cf39dc90b51cb0bfeee8698050
spent
true